The successful candidate's duties and responsibilities will encompass the following:

  • Ensure products and processes adhere to EU regulations (primarily REACH), specifically concerning Substances of Very High Concern (SVHCs)
  • Determine if products exceed the 0.1% w/w threshold for SVHCs, gathering necessary chemical information from procurement and the supply chain
  • Conduct or coordinate laboratory testing to confirm material composition and maintain a database of compliance data gathered from vendors
  • Prepare regulatory submissions, update Safety Data Sheets (SDS), technical files, and declarations of conformity
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ement environmental compliance for new accessory partners and develop risk management strategies for SVHC replacement/phase-out
